The Need for High-Performance Modular Construction

To address these challenges, property owners are increasingly turning towards high-performance modular construction as a viable solution. Modular construction involves prefabricating components off-site in controlled factory environments before transporting them to the building site where they are assembled. This approach offers numerous advantages over traditional methods: 1. **Faster Project Delivery**: By manufacturing parts in factories, modular construction can significantly reduce on-site labor and weather-related delays. The assembly process is faster because it involves fewer steps compared to conventional site-built structures. 2. **Higher Quality Control**: Factory settings allow for better quality control measures due to standardized processes and continuous monitoring. This ensures that all components meet stringent specifications before being transported to the building site. 3. **Sustainability**: Modular construction often uses eco-friendly materials and incorporates energy-efficient designs, reducing overall environmental impact. The factory environment also minimizes waste generation and maximizes recycling opportunities. 4. **Cost-Effectiveness**: While initial costs may be higher due to the need for specialized equipment and transportation, long-term savings can be substantial. Reduced labor on-site, minimized material waste, and lower maintenance requirements all contribute to cost savings over time. 5. **Flexibility and Customization**: Modular systems offer greater flexibility in design choices while still maintaining structural integrity. This allows for more innovative architectural solutions that meet specific client needs without compromising quality or safety standards.

Tailored Solutions for Bali’s Unique Climate

Given the unique climate conditions in Bali—characterized by high humidity levels, tropical rains, and occasional cyclonic storms—it is essential to use appropriate materials and techniques when constructing buildings here. Neurostruct Engineering excels at adapting our modular systems to withstand these challenging environmental factors while maintaining structural integrity. For instance, we often utilize moisture-resistant insulation and waterproofing membranes during the manufacturing phase. Additionally, our prefabricated units are designed with enhanced ventilation options to help regulate internal temperatures effectively, thereby reducing reliance on air conditioning systems and lowering overall energy consumption.
